Career Role (Advanced Inspection Techniques) Description
Senior Non-Destructive Testing (NDT) Engineer Lead complex NDT projects, manage teams, and ensure regulatory compliance in diverse industries like aerospace and energy. High demand for advanced inspection expertise.
Quality Control Specialist (Advanced Imaging) Utilize cutting-edge imaging techniques like 3D scanning and digital radiography for precise quality assessment in manufacturing and construction. Expertise in image analysis is key.
Robotics and Automation Engineer (Inspection) Develop and implement automated inspection systems using robotics and AI, improving efficiency and accuracy in challenging inspection environments. Strong programming skills required.
Data Analyst (Inspection Data) Analyze large datasets from inspection processes to identify trends, predict failures, and improve overall quality control. Expertise in statistical analysis and data visualization is vital.
